Corundum Is the Mineral Framework Behind Ruby and Sapphire Terminology

Corundum is the mineral family that gives ruby and sapphire their shared gemological background. In simplified terms, ruby is the red gem variety of corundum, while sapphire is commonly used for non-red gem corundum, with blue sapphire being the best-known example. This is why ruby and sapphire can be discussed together in material education even though they are not interchangeable names in a finished bead description. The relationship is mineralogical first: both terms point back to corundum, but the gem variety name depends on color and gemological classification. For a material comparison reader, this helps separate the upper-level mineral concept from the commercial wording used in loose gemstone jewelry beads, sapphire beads, or ruby sapphire beads. That distinction matters because corundum knowledge explains a category relationship, not a specific bead’s identity. If a listing, URL, or title uses sapphire, star ruby sapphire, or black red gemstone beads wording, the reader can understand why the words might be grouped, but should not conclude that the object has been tested as ruby, sapphire, or corundum. Industry sources such as GIA and Minerals Education Coalition are useful for explaining ruby, sapphire, and corundum as general gemstone concepts. They do not authenticate a particular strand, bead lot, or online sapphire sale entry. The safer mental model is layered: corundum is the mineral background, ruby and sapphire are gem variety terms, and product naming is a separate communication layer that may or may not be supported by detailed specifications, images, or testing.

Combined Bead Names Can Carry Several Meanings Without Proving Material Composition

Phrases such as ruby sapphire beads and star ruby sapphire are easy to overread because they compress several ideas into a short commercial label. A buyer or content editor may see “ruby” and “sapphire” side by side and assume the bead contains both materials, or see “star” and assume a verified optical phenomenon. In practice, combined wording can serve different functions. It may describe a color impression, refer to a gem family, repeat popular search terms, or attempt to name a specific gem-like appearance. None of those possibilities is the same as confirmed composition.

A shared corundum background can explain word grouping without proving the bead

Because ruby and sapphire both belong within corundum-based gemstone terminology, a writer may place the words near each other to signal a related gem family. That grouping can be educationally coherent, especially in a material explanation about ruby, sapphire, and corundum. However, the logic only works at the concept level. It does not show that a loose bead strand has been tested as corundum, that red areas are ruby, or that darker areas are sapphire. The mineral framework explains why the terms are related; it does not identify a product. Color language adds another layer of possible misunderstanding. In bead naming, ruby may evoke red tones, while sapphire may evoke blue, dark, or gem-like associations. A phrase such as black red sapphire may therefore be partly visual, partly commercial, and partly mineral-related. Without clear material description, images, or testing, the reader cannot know which layer is intended. The phrase may be useful as a naming clue, but it remains weaker than a direct, supported material statement.

Search oriented wording can imitate material language while remaining unverified

Search behavior also shapes gemstone bead titles. When users search sapphire for sale or sapphire sale, product names may include familiar gemstone terms to match browsing intent. This can make a phrase look more material-specific than the available evidence allows. A title may combine ruby, sapphire, star, starlight, beads, necklaces, and bracelets because those words connect with how people browse loose gemstone jewelry beads. That does not automatically mean each word has equal technical weight. The same caution applies to star ruby sapphire. The word “star” can relate to star ruby or star sapphire concepts in gemology, but a bead name using star ruby sapphire does not automatically demonstrate a visible star effect, a tested stone type, or a combined ruby-sapphire composition. A phrase can be useful for organizing information, but it should not be converted into stronger claims such as certified sapphire, guaranteed genuine star ruby, or verified natural corundum unless supporting information is present. In gem materials, the stronger the claim, the more it depends on evidence outside the name itself. Here, the key point is narrow: combined terminology can point toward a concept, while actual composition requires confirmation.

FAQ

 Q:Are ruby and sapphire both related to corundum in gemstone terminology?

A:Yes. In standard gemstone terminology, ruby and sapphire are both related to corundum. Ruby is generally understood as the red gem variety of corundum, while sapphire refers to other gem corundum varieties, most famously blue sapphire. This shared mineral background explains why the terms often appear together in educational discussions, but it does not mean every bead name using both words has been verified as corundum.

 Q:Does the phrase star ruby sapphire prove that a bead contains both ruby and sapphire?

A:No. The phrase star ruby sapphire does not, by itself, prove that a bead contains both ruby and sapphire. It may be a combined naming phrase, a search-oriented term, a color or style description, or an unverified material claim. To treat it as confirmed composition, a reader would need supporting material information, clear product details, or appropriate gemological verification.

 Q:Why is corundum knowledge useful when reading sapphire sale product names?

A:Corundum knowledge helps because it gives readers a structured way to interpret ruby and sapphire language without overclaiming. When a sapphire sale name includes ruby, sapphire, star, or bead-related wording, understanding corundum clarifies the family relationship while reminding readers that a name is not the same as identification. It supports better material reading and more cautious content interpretation.
